xtensa: add IRQ domains support

IRQ domains provide a mechanism for conversion of linux IRQ numbers to
hardware IRQ numbers and vice versus. It is used by OpenFirmware for
linking device tree objects to their respective interrupt controllers.

+/*
+ * Device Tree IRQ specifier translation function which works with one or
+ * two cell bindings. First cell value maps directly to the hwirq number.
+ * Second cell if present specifies whether hwirq number is external (1) or
+ * internal (0).
+ */
+int xtensa_irq_domain_xlate(struct irq_domain *d, struct device_node *ctrlr,
+		const u32 *intspec, unsigned int intsize,
+		unsigned long *out_hwirq, unsigned int *out_type)
+{
+	if (WARN_ON(intsize < 1 || intsize > 2))
+		return -EINVAL;
+	if (intsize == 2 && intspec[1] == 1) {
+		unsigned int_irq = map_ext_irq(intspec[0]);
+		if (int_irq < XCHAL_NUM_INTERRUPTS)
+			*out_hwirq = int_irq;
+		else
+			return -EINVAL;
+	} else {
+		*out_hwirq = intspec[0];
+	}
+	*out_type = IRQ_TYPE_NONE;
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static const struct irq_domain_ops xtensa_irq_domain_ops = {
+	.xlate = xtensa_irq_domain_xlate,
+	.map = xtensa_irq_map,
+};
